A length of a rectangle is four times the width. What is the perimeter of a rectangle with width 13 inches? A. 52 inches B. 60 inches C. 65 inches D. 130 inches

rebeccaxhawaii (rebeccaxhawaii):

13 x 4 = 52 52 + 52 + 13 +13 = 130

rebeccaxhawaii (rebeccaxhawaii):

13 is the width and the length is 4 x width giving you 52 perimeter is L+L+w+w
